ftype 命令显示或修改文件扩展名链接中使用的文件类型。如果不使用赋值运算符 (=),ftype 命令将显示指定文件类型的当前打开命令字符串。如果不带参数使用,ftype 命令将显示具有指定命令序列的文件类型。
该命令的使用示例,请看下面的示例。
Cu ftype条例
ftype [[=[]]]
参数
参数说明 指定要显示或更改的文件类型。指定打开指定文件类型的文件时要使用的打开命令字符串。/?在命令提示符处显示帮助。注意
下表描述了ftype命令如何替换打开的命令字符串中的变量:
变量替换值%0 或%1 替换为通过链接启动的文件名。 % * 获取所有参数。 % 2, % 3,.取第一个参数(%2),第二个参数(%3)等。%~ 获取从第N个参数开始的所有剩余参数,其中N可以是2到9之间的任意数字。例如
用定义的命令序列显示当前文件类型,输入:
ftype
要显示txtfile文件类型的当前打开命令字符串,输入:
ftype txtfile
此命令产生以下结果:
txtfile=%SystemRoot%system32NOTEPAD.EXE %1
要删除名为示例的文件类型的打开命令字符串,输入:
ftype example=
要将.pl 文件扩展名链接到 PerlScript 文件类型并允许 PerlScript 文件类型运行 PERL.EXE,请输入以下命令:
assoc.pl=PerlScript ftype PerlScript=perl.exe %1 %*
要在调用 Perl 脚本时无需键入.pl 文件扩展名,请键入:
set PATHEXT=.pl;%PATHEXT%
查看更多:
- Windows 中的火锅命令
- Windows 中的 Findstr 命令
- Windows 中的 Freedisk 命令
评论